Week Today is a weekly women's magazine published by Pabel-Moewig Verlag (a subsidiary of the Bauer Media Group ). The editorial office is in Rastatt. The editor-in-chief is Dirk Hentschel.

Target group, content and focus

Week Today is aimed at readers between 30 and 59 years of age. The focus is on reports and reports from the world of stars and the nobility, advice on classic women's issues such as fashion, cosmetics and wellness as well as puzzles and competitions. In comparison to other magazines in this segment, Woche today also has a particularly detailed medical section.
